The inverse square law of intensity \[\left(\text{i.e. the intensity }\infty \frac{1}{r^2}\right)\] is valid for a ____________ .

Options

  • point source

  • line source

  • plane source

  • cylindrical source

Solution

point source

 

Intensity of a point source obeys the inverse square law.

Intensity of light at distance r from the point source is given by

\[I = S/\left( 4 \pi r^2 \right)\]

where S is the source strength.
